Fiberglass shingles repair services involve fixing damaged or deteriorating shingles made from fiberglass materials, which are commonly used in residential roofing. Over time, fiberglass shingles can develop issues such as cracking, curling, blistering, or missing sections due to weather exposure, aging, or impact damage. Skilled service providers assess the condition of the shingles, identify areas needing attention, and perform repairs that restore the roof’s integrity. This process often includes replacing broken shingles, sealing leaks, and reinforcing areas that show signs of wear, helping to extend the lifespan of the roofing system.
Many problems can be addressed through fiberglass shingles repair, including leaks caused by cracked or missing shingles, wind damage that lifts or tears shingles, and general wear from prolonged exposure to the elements. Repair work can also prevent further damage, such as water infiltration, which might lead to mold or structural issues inside the property. Homeowners often seek these services when noticing water stains on ceilings, increased energy bills due to poor insulation, or visible damage on the roof’s surface. Prompt repairs can help maintain the roof’s protective barrier and avoid more costly replacements down the line.

The overview below groups typical Fiberglass Shingles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Joplin, MO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Most minor fiberglass shingle repairs in Joplin typ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ine fixes, such as replacing a few damaged shingles, fall within this range. Larger or more complex repairs may require additional investment.
Moderate Repairs - Mid-sized projects, including partial roof repairs or patching multiple areas, generally range from $600 to $1,500. These are common for homeowners addressing multiple damaged shingles or minor leaks.
Full Shingle Replacement - Replacing an entire section or the full roof with fiberglass shingles can cost between $3,000 and $7,000. Most projects in this range are for larger homes or extensive damage, with fewer cases reaching the higher end.
Complete Roof Replacement - For full roof replacements, including removal and installation, costs often range from $7,000 to $15,000 or more. Larger, more complex projects can exceed this range, depending on the roof size and material choices.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my fiberglass shingles need repair? Signs such as cracked, curled, or missing shingles, along with leaks or water stains inside the home, can indicate the need for fiberglass shingle repair services from local contractors.
What types of damage can fiberglass shingles be repaired for? Common issues include cracks, curling, blistering, and broken or missing shingles, all of which local service providers can address through repair or replacement.
Are repairs to fiberglass shingles a temporary or permanent solution? Repairs can vary in durability depending on the extent of damage; consulting with local contractors can help determine the best approach for long-lasting results.
Can fiberglass shingles be repaired without replacing the entire roof? In many cases, damaged shingles can be repaired or replaced individually, avoiding the need for a full roof replacement, with assistance from experienced local service providers.
